Kentucky Bluegrass

Kentucky Bluegrass is the most widely used grass for lawns in the Colorado Springs area. It is a perennial, cool season turfgrass that spreads by rhizomes, producing a thick sod.

For areas that will have heavy foot traffic from children or pets, Kentucky bluegrass is a good choice.

Although it requires regular watering to keep it green and prevent winterkill, Kentucky bluegrass can go dormant (turn brown) during dry periods and recover when moisture becomes available.

It requires regular watering (3 days per week in mid-summer) to keep it green and healthy. Plant it on a flat, sunny area and use efficient sprinkler heads and nozzles to water it wisely.
